APT Package Release Process
This guide documents the process for publishing NoETL CLI releases as Debian packages via APT repository.
Overview
NoETL provides .deb packages for Ubuntu/Debian distributions, hosted via GitHub Pages as an APT repository. The process involves building packages, creating repository metadata, and publishing to GitHub.

Build Process
1. Build Debian Package
Option A: Docker Build (Recommended for macOS)
Build using Docker to avoid needing Linux system:
./docker/release/build-deb-docker.sh 2.5.3
This script:
- Builds Ubuntu 22.04 container with Rust toolchain
- Compiles Rust binary with cargo
- Creates debian package structure
- Generates
.debfile with proper control metadata - Extracts package and SHA256 checksum to
build/deb/
Output:
build/deb/noetl_2.5.3-1_amd64.deb
build/deb/noetl_2.5.3-1_amd64.deb.sha256

2. Create APT Repository
Generate repository metadata:
./scripts/publish_apt.sh 2.5.3 amd64
This creates:
apt-repo/
├── dists/
│ ├── jammy/ # Ubuntu 22.04
│ ├── focal/ # Ubuntu 20.04
│ └── noble/ # Ubuntu 24.04
│ └── main/
│ └── binary-amd64/
│ ├── Packages
│ ├── Packages.gz
│ └── Release
└── pool/
└── main/
└── noetl_2.5.3-1_amd64.deb

Package Structure
Control File (debian/control)
Defines package metadata and dependencies:
Package: noetl
Version: 2.5.3-1
Architecture: amd64
Maintainer: NoETL Team <[email protected]>
Description: NoETL workflow automation CLI
Depends: ${shlibs:Depends}
Build Rules (debian/rules)
Makefile for building:
#!/usr/bin/make -f
override_dh_auto_build:
cd crates/noetlctl && cargo build --release
override_dh_auto_install:
install -D -m 0755 target/release/noetl debian/noetl/usr/bin/noetl

Multi-Architecture Support
Build for ARM64:
# Setup cross-compilation
rustup target add aarch64-unknown-linux-gnu
sudo apt-get install gcc-aarch64-linux-gnu
# Build with cargo
export CARGO_TARGET_AARCH64_UNKNOWN_LINUX_GNU_LINKER=aarch64-linux-gnu-gcc
cargo build --release --target aarch64-unknown-linux-gnu -p noetl-cli
# Build .deb for arm64
./scripts/build_deb.sh 2.5.3 arm64
Troubleshooting
Build fails with cargo errors
Ensure Rust is up to date:
rustup update stable
cargo clean
dpkg-deb not found
Install debian build tools:
sudo apt-get install dpkg-dev
Repository metadata errors
Regenerate Packages file:
cd apt-repo
dpkg-scanpackages --arch amd64 pool/ > dists/jammy/main/binary-amd64/Packages
gzip -k -f dists/jammy/main/binary-amd64/Packages
